Carpet Water Damage Restoration Cost in Sunset Valley, TX
The cost of Carpet Water Damage Restoration can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sunset Valley, TX.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an for your home.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ted |
| Carpet Cleaning and Disinfection |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of carpet or flooring |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used |
| Final Inspection and Quality Control |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the restoration process and the number of technicians involved |
| Documentation and Claims Handling | $0 – $500 | The complexity of the claims process and the number of insurance companies involved |

Common Questions About Carpet Water Damage Restoration
Q: How long does the restoration process take?
A: The restoration process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to ensure the process is completed as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Q: How can I prevent water damage in the future?
A: To prevent water damage, ensure your home is properly maintained, including regular inspections and repairs. You can also install a sump pump or water alarm to detect potential issues early on. Our team can provide you with more tips and recommendations to prevent water damage in the future.
